在数字化时代,网络安全已成为全球关注的焦点。随着互联网技术的飞速发展,网络攻击手段也日益复杂多样。为了确保用户账户和敏感信息的安全,双向验证(Two-Factor Authentication,简称2FA)应运而生。本文将深入探讨双向验证框架的工作原理、优势以及如何守护数字世界。
一、什么是双向验证?
双向验证,顾名思义,需要在两个不同的认证要素上进行验证。通常,这包括用户名和密码(知识因素)以及手机短信、动态令牌、指纹或面部识别(非知识因素)。只有当这两个要素都通过验证时,用户才能成功登录系统。
二、双向验证框架的工作原理
- 用户登录:用户输入用户名和密码。
- 知识因素验证:系统验证用户名和密码的正确性。
- 非知识因素验证:系统向用户发送验证码(如手机短信、动态令牌等)。
- 用户输入验证码:用户在系统中输入收到的验证码。
- 系统验证:系统验证验证码的正确性。
- 登录成功:如果两个要素都通过验证,用户成功登录。
三、双向验证的优势
- 提高安全性:双向验证增加了攻击者入侵系统的难度,有效防止了密码泄露、钓鱼攻击等安全风险。
- 降低欺诈风险:即使攻击者获得了用户的密码,没有第二个认证要素,也无法成功登录。
- 增强用户体验:双向验证并非绝对繁琐,合理的设计可以使用户体验流畅,同时保障安全。
四、双向验证框架在守护数字世界中的应用
- 金融领域:银行、证券等金融机构采用双向验证框架,保障用户资金安全。
- 电子商务:电商平台通过双向验证,降低用户账户被盗用风险。
- 社交网络:社交平台采用双向验证,保护用户隐私和数据安全。
- 政府机构:政府部门利用双向验证框架,保障国家信息安全。
五、双向验证框架的发展趋势
- 生物识别技术:随着生物识别技术的成熟,指纹、面部识别等将成为双向验证的重要手段。
- 多因素认证:未来,多因素认证将成为主流,结合多种认证要素,进一步提升安全性。
- 智能认证:利用人工智能技术,实现更加智能、个性化的双向验证。
总之,双向验证框架在守护数字世界方面发挥着重要作用。随着技术的不断发展,双向验证将更加完善,为用户提供更加安全、便捷的服务。
